본 발명은 이동통신 기기에 관한 것으로서, 보다 상세하게는 휴대폰 등과 같은 이동통신 기기의 사용시 인체의 중요 기관인 머리(뇌)가 휴대폰의 안테나로부터 발생되는 고주파수의 전자파로부터 손상되는 것을 효과적으로 방지할 수 있는 이동통신 기기에 관한 것이다.The present invention relates to a mobile communication device, and more particularly, a mobile device capable of effectively preventing the head (brain), which is an important organ of the human body, from being damaged from high frequency electromagnetic waves generated from an antenna of a mobile phone when using a mobile communication device such as a mobile phone. It relates to a communication device.
일반적으로, 휴대폰, PCS 단말기 등과 같은 이동 통신기기는 매우 높은 주파수(약 800∼1600㎒)대역의 전자파를 사용하게 되는 바, 이로 인해 휴대폰 사용시에는 안테나에서 고주파수의 전자파가 발생하게된다.In general, a mobile communication device such as a mobile phone or a PCS terminal uses electromagnetic waves having a very high frequency (about 800 to 1600 MHz) band, and thus high frequency electromagnetic waves are generated from an antenna when using a mobile phone.
상기한 이동 통신기기 중 휴대폰에 대해 설명하면, 도3에 도시된 바와 같이 플립 타입의 경우, 다수의 버튼이 순차 배치됨과 아울러 마이크 및 스피커가 설치된 본체(40)와, 상기한 본체(40)에 회전 가능하게 설치된 플립(50)과, 상기한 본체(40)의 상단에는 인출/삽입 가능하게 설치된 안테나(10)로 구성되어 있다.Referring to the mobile phone of the above-mentioned mobile communication device, as shown in Figure 3, in the flip type, a plurality of buttons are arranged in sequence, the main body 40 is provided with a microphone and a speaker, and the main body 40 The flip 50 is provided to be rotatable, and the antenna 10 is provided at the upper end of the main body 40 to be pulled out / insertable.
물론, 상기한 본체(40)의 내부에는 도시되지 않은 별도의 통신 프로그램 등이 내장된 회로 칩과 고주파발생장치가 내장되어 있어 이로부터 발생되는 고주파를 안테나(10)를 통하여 외부로 송신함으로서 무선통화가 가능하게 되는 것이다. 상기한 바와 같은 휴대폰의 사용 상태를 설명하면, 플립형의 경우 플립(50)을 열고 상기한 다수의 버튼이 설치된 키패드에서 소정 번호를 누른 후, 상기한 본체(40)의 스피커)를 귀에 밀착시키게 된다.Of course, the main body 40 has a circuit chip and a high frequency generator in which a separate communication program, etc., which is not illustrated, are embedded, and the radio frequency is transmitted to the outside through the antenna 10. Will be possible. Referring to the state of use of the mobile phone as described above, in the flip type, the flip 50 is opened, the predetermined number is pressed on the keypad provided with the plurality of buttons, and the speaker of the main body 40 is brought into close contact with the ear. .
여기서, 상기한 휴대폰의 송/수신안테나(10)에서 발생되는 전자파는, 안테나와 인접된 뇌세포 또는 신경 조직을 자극하거나 손상을 주게되고, 더욱이 휴대폰을 장기간 사용할 경우에는 고주파에 노출되는 시간이 길어져서 뇌 세포의 손상은 더욱 더 커질 수 밖에 없는 것이다.Here, the electromagnetic waves generated by the transmitting / receiving antenna 10 of the mobile phone stimulate or damage brain cells or neural tissues adjacent to the antenna. Moreover, when using the mobile phone for a long time, the time to be exposed to high frequency is long. The damage to the brain cells is inevitably even greater.
또한, 종래의 휴대폰에 장착된 안테나는 휴대폰 본체(40)의 상부에 위치하여 휴대폰 사용시 이를 인출하기가 어렵고 번거럽다는 문제점도 있었다.In addition, the antenna mounted on the conventional mobile phone is also located on the top of the mobile phone main body 40 has a problem that it is difficult and cumbersome to pull out when using the mobile phone.
따라서, 본 발명의 목적은 상기한 제반 문제점을 해결하기 위한 것으로서, 휴대폰 사용시 고주파수의 전자파 발생 장치인 안테나가 머리(뇌)와 최대한 이격된 상태에서 송/수신 할수 있도록 구성함과 아울러, 전자파차단물질을 휴대폰플립(50)의 외측면에 도포하는 이동통신 기기를 제공함에 있다.Accordingly, an object of the present invention is to solve the above-mentioned problems, and to configure the antenna, which is a high frequency electromagnetic wave generating device when using a mobile phone, to transmit / receive as far as possible from the head (brain), and to block the electromagnetic wave. The present invention provides a mobile communication device for coating the outer surface of the mobile phone flip 50.
상기한 목적을 달성하기 위한 본 발명의 기술적 구성은 고주파수의 전자파를 사용하여 무선으로 송/수신할 수 있는 이동통신 기기에 있어서,Technical composition of the present invention for achieving the above object is a mobile communication device capable of transmitting and receiving wirelessly using high-frequency electromagnetic waves,
고주파를 발생하는 안테나가 이동통신기기의 본체의 하측에 설치되고, 본체와 일체로 결합됨과 아울러 사용시 회동가능한 플립의 외측면에는 전자파 차단물질이 도포됨을 특징으로 한다.An antenna generating high frequency is installed on the lower side of the main body of the mobile communication device, and is integrally coupled with the main body, and an electromagnetic wave shielding material is coated on the outer surface of the fliptable when used.

도1과 도2는 본 발명에 따른 이동 통신기기의 사용 상태를 도시한 개략 정면도와 사시도로서, 이동 통신기기 중 하나인 플립형 휴대폰의 본체(40) 하측에 안테나(10)가 삽입 설치되어 있을 뿐만 아니라 상기한 플립(50)의 외측표면에 전자파 차단제(20)가 도포 되어 있다.1 and 2 are schematic front and perspective views showing a state of use of the mobile communication device according to the present invention, in which an antenna 10 is inserted below the main body 40 of a flip type mobile phone, which is one of the mobile communication devices. Instead, the electromagnetic wave shield 20 is applied to the outer surface of the flip 50.
즉, 상기 본체(40)에 나사 결합되는 끼움 부재(10) 및 상기 끼움부재(10)에 삽입되어 본체(40)내에 슬라이드 이동 가능한 안테나(10)가 휴대폰 본체(40) 하측에 위치하도록 구성되어 있다.That is, the fitting member 10 screwed to the main body 40 and the antenna 10 inserted into the fitting member 10 and movable in the main body 40 are configured to be positioned below the mobile phone main body 40. have.
전자파 차단제(20)는 예를 들면, 도전성과 자성을 지닌 금속 분말을 미세한 흑연 분말 등과 혼합하여 겔(GEL) 상태로 형성한 후 이를 플립(50)의 외측면에 도포하여 고형화시키면 전자파 차단제(20)가 형성되는 것이다.For example, the electromagnetic wave shield 20 is formed by mixing the conductive and magnetic metal powder with fine graphite powder and the like to form a gel (GEL), and then applying the same to the outer surface of the flip 50 to solidify the electromagnetic wave blocker 20. ) Is formed.
여기서, 상기 전자파 차단제(20)는 상기 물질에 한정되는 것이 아니며 기술문헌에 알려져 있는 모든 전자파차단물질을 포함함은 물론이다.Here, the electromagnetic wave shield 20 is not limited to the above materials and includes all electromagnetic wave blocking materials known in the technical literature.
상기한 바와 같이 구성된 본 발명의 작용 효과를 설명하면, 사용자가 휴대폰을 사용하기 위하여, 플립(50)을 열고 키패드에서 소정 버튼을 누른 후 스피커를 귀로 밀착시키게 된다.Referring to the operation and effect of the present invention configured as described above, in order to use the mobile phone, the user opens the flip 50, presses a predetermined button on the keypad and the speaker is in close contact with the ears.
이 과정에서 상기 안테나(10)에서 고주파수의 전자파가 발생되게 되는데, 상기 안테나(10)가 본체(40)의 하측에 설치되어 머리(뇌)와 상당히 이격되어 있으므로 그 전자파의 피해강도는 상대적으로 크게 약화되고, 또한 상기 플립(50)의 외측면에 도포된 전자파 차단물질(20)이 고주파수의 전자파를 차단하는 역할을 하게 된다.In this process, high frequency electromagnetic waves are generated in the antenna 10. Since the antenna 10 is installed below the main body 40 and is substantially spaced from the head (brain), the damage strength of the electromagnetic waves is relatively large. Weakened, the electromagnetic wave blocking material 20 applied to the outer surface of the flip 50 serves to block the electromagnetic waves of high frequency.
또한, 도4 내지 도6에 제시된 폴더형 휴대폰에 있어서도 안테나의 장착되는 위치를 본체의 하측으로 향하게 하고 플립의 외측면에 전자파 차단물질을 도포하면 동일한 작용을 지니게 됨은 물론이다.In addition, in the folding cellular phone shown in Figs. 4 to 6, the mounting position of the antenna is directed downward and the electromagnetic wave shielding material is applied to the outer surface of the flip.
또한, 본 발명의 휴대폰 사용시 통신감도가 미약해서 안테나(10)를 인출해야 할 경우에 안테나(10)를 용이하게 빼낼 수 있게 되어 있는 바, 종래와 같이 안테나(10)가 본체(40) 상측에 설치되어 있는 경우 팔을 머리위로 올려 안테나(10)를 인출하거나 안테나(10)를 인출하기 위해 휴대폰을 귀로부터 분리해야 하는 등의 통화 불편을 해소할 수 있는 것이다.In addition, when the use of the mobile phone of the present invention has a weak communication sensitivity, the antenna 10 can be easily pulled out when the antenna 10 needs to be drawn out. As shown in the related art, the antenna 10 is located above the main body 40. If it is installed to raise the arm above the head to withdraw the antenna 10 or to withdraw the antenna 10 to eliminate the inconvenience of the call, such as having to remove the mobile phone from the ear.
상술한 것과 같이 본 발명은 고주파를 사용하는 이동 통신 기기에 안테나를 본체 하측에 설치하고, 또한 본체와 회동되게 결합된 플립의 외측면에 전자파 차단물질을 도포 함으로서 안테나에서 방출되는 고주파수의 전자파로부터 머리(뇌)를 효과적으로 보호할 수 있는 잇점을 지니고 있다.As described above, the present invention provides a head from a high frequency electromagnetic wave emitted from the antenna by installing an antenna below the main body in a mobile communication device using high frequency and applying an electromagnetic wave shielding material to the outer surface of the flip coupled to the main body. It has the advantage of effectively protecting the brain.
